The Blender SMD Tools allow Blender 2.5x to import and export Studiomdl Data files.
Installation
- Download the script (latest release August 12th 2010)
- In Blender, open File > User Preferences, move to the Add-Ons tab and click Install Add-On in the bottom of the window
- Check the SMD Tools' box to enable them
- Click Save as Default to enable the tools in all Blend files
Known issues
- Animation is not yet supported for import or export.
- No UI on errors.
